Make Up For Ever I872 Pearly Pink Artist Shadow
Make Up For Ever I872 Pearly Pink Artist Shadow ($21.00 for 0.08 oz.) is a brightened, cool-toned light pink with a pearly, almost metallic, sheen. It had excellent color payoff with a soft, dense texture that was a cinch to work with. It wore well for almost nine hours before creasing slightly. ColourPop Sugar Plum (P, $5.00) is less metallic. Make Up For Ever D862 Fairly Pink Artist Shadow ($21.00 for 0.08 oz.) is a sparkling, light-medium pink with warm, yellow undertones and a frosted finish with sparkle. It had good color payoff, though not quite opaque, that was buildable to fully opaque color very easily. The texture was soft, smooth, and blendable on the skin. It adhered well without a fuss, and the color itself lasted well for almost nine hours, but I did have some fall out over time. ColourPop Bubbly (P, $5.00) is a cream product. Make Up For Ever I824 Ocher Pink Artist Shadow ($21.00 for 0.08 oz.) is a copper-red with warm undertones and a soft, pearly finish. It had excellent color payoff–a little goes a long way–with a buttery, dense, and smooth consistency that applied like a dream. This shade really exemplifies what makes the Artist Shadow range so fantastic. It wore well for nine and a half hours before creasing.
